Rottweiler Overview
Powerful and muscular, Rottweilers showcase a robust, balanced build with a broad head and strong jaws. Their black coat with mahogany markings complements their confident stance and alert expression. Distinguished by their natural guarding instincts, these dogs combine strength with remarkable agility, displaying a calm yet watchful demeanor that reflects their working heritage.
Russian Tsvetnaya Bolonka Overview
Russian Tsvetnaya Bolonka is a small, charming companion dog with a distinctive long, wavy coat that comes in various colors. Standing 9-10 inches tall, these elegant dogs feature a rounded head, expressive dark eyes, and a medium-length muzzle. Their sturdy yet delicate build combines with a cheerful, inquisitive personality to create an ideal lap dog that maintains an alert and lively demeanor.

Health & Lifespan
Rottweiler Health Profile
Common Health Issues:
- Hip Dysplasia
- Elbow Dysplasia
- Heart Problems
- Eye Issues
- Osteosarcoma
Russian Tsvetnaya Bolonka Health Profile
Common Health Issues:
- Patellar Luxation
- Progressive Retinal Atrophy
- Heart Murmurs
- Dental Issues
- Hip Dysplasia
